About Josh
Josh is a Managing Associate in our Liverpool office and has over 6 years’ experience of Financial Services Regulatory law.
Josh supports and provides advice to a wide range of clients on all aspects of financial services regulation including insurance, reinsurance and alternative risk transfer, discretionary benefits schemes, credit related regulated activities, regulated claims management, funds, CISs and AIFs, and regulated home finance. Josh has a particular interest in the regulation of digital assets and cryptoassets, including stablecoins.
Josh’s broad regulatory experience includes regulatory due diligence, perimeter and compliance guidance, change in control advice, and policy wording interpretation, particularly transactional risk insurance policies used in M&A activity, property transactions, environmental projects, and insolvency proceedings.
In addition to the financial services work he carries out, Josh also advises Solicitors Regulation Authority regulated persons and Bar Standards Board regulated persons in relation to non-contentious issues and regulatory structuring, particularly in the context of M&A activity, litigation funding, and private equity investment.
Josh enjoys public speaking and recording podcasts. He has delivered in-person and remote student careers presentations and CPD training for law firms, members of the Chartered Institute of Taxation and members of the Association of Insurance and Risk Managers in Industry and Commerce.

Notable work & expertise
-
Advised the consumer credit lending division of a large motor vehicle manufacturer in connection with the calculation of early settlement and partial settlements
-
Advised a Liechtenstein domiciled bank on whether it would breach the parameters of its SRO status by providing finance secured against a UK real estate asset, to a Luxembourg SPV
-
Advised a Sharia compliant AIFM on whether the underlying Sharia securities constituted eligible investments for IF-ISA status under the Individual Savings Account Regulations 1998
-
Advised the issuer of 1:1 £GBP backed stablecoins on its requirement to become FCA authorised and be registered with the FCA under the MLRs 2017 as a cryptoasset business
-
Advised a cryptoasset asset investment business in relation to the regulatory compliance of its advanced hedging strategy which combined staking Ethereum, taking a short position on the BTC perpetual futures market, and a long position on the BTC spot market
-
Undertook regulatory due diligence in connection with the listing of MHA plc on AIM
